Pinned Repositories
julia
The Julia Programming Language
GraphEngine
Microsoft Graph Engine
purescript-python
A Python backend for PureScript.
cpython
The Python programming language
CanonicalTraits.jl
Full-featured traits in Julia. Without full features how dare I say this?
diojit
Fully compatible CPython jit compiler. Optimising Dynamic, Interpreted, and Object-oriented(DIO) programs.
MLStyle.jl
Julia functional programming infrastructures and metaprogramming facilities
moshmosh
An amazing syntax extension system in pure Python, the way to coding efficiency.
Quick-Backend
Idris, make back end, in 15 minutes, reusable, concise: https://bitbucket.org/thautwarm/ppl2020-idris-codegen-backend/src/master
restrain-jit
The first and yet the only CPython compatible Python JIT, over the world.(julia backend: https://github.com/thautwarm/RestrainJIT.jl)
thautwarm's Repositories
thautwarm/MLStyle.jl
Julia functional programming infrastructures and metaprogramming facilities
thautwarm/CanonicalTraits.jl
Full-featured traits in Julia. Without full features how dare I say this?
thautwarm/Typed-BNF
Statically typed BNF with semantic actions; safe parser generator applicable to every programming language.
thautwarm/RBNF.jl
A DSL for modern parsing
thautwarm/DevOnly.jl
Using runtime-free macro packages as dev-only dependencies.
thautwarm/MLStyle-Playground
Examples for MLStyle.jl
thautwarm/original-posting
Original posting, a.k.a. OP, is an ALL-IN-ONE markup language for cyber wizards to create documentations and blog pages.
thautwarm/autojmp
autojump implementation that is applicable to any shell and any OS
thautwarm/Site-33
https://thautwarm.github.io/Site-33/
thautwarm/nomake
thautwarm/LanguageCollections
programming languages invented/implemented by myself.
thautwarm/julia-android-example
Running Julia Code on Android with Flutter (UI) & Rust (Build System) & SyslabCC (Julia AOT Compiler)
thautwarm/PrettyDoc.jl
An easy-to-use and lightweight text layout combinator library, serving high-quality pretty printing, text code generation, etc.
thautwarm/oglob
oglob: Python's composable file searching as a powerful `glob` alternative without a learning curve.
thautwarm/SGtk.jl
Lightweight Gtk binding for Julia compatible to Julia AOT solutions like SyslabCC & juliac
thautwarm/zit
Z it! A single executable that integrates functionalities of tar/unzip/zip/zstd for all desktop platforms.
thautwarm/panpanneed
Your local cloud drive implemented in one-liner code.
thautwarm/bdwgc-build
Build and distribute shared libraries for Boehm-Demers-Weiser conservative C/C++ Garbage Collector. Use Zig for cross compilation.
thautwarm/dotnet-bdwgc
Experiments about changing .NET GC to bdwgc
thautwarm/dtschema
thautwarm/Pack1.jl
A single-file Julia libray using pack(1) alignment to pack value-typed instances into UInt8 arrays with extensible endianness.
thautwarm/subproc_mgr
A service to spawn and manage long-running child processes, following the lifecycle management of "child processes are attached to parent processes".
thautwarm/BLiveVote
基于blivedm的直播观众投票器
thautwarm/CSTParser.jl
A concrete syntax tree parser for Julia
thautwarm/Fable.SimpleXml
A library for easily parsing and working with XML in Fable projects
thautwarm/HMCMT2D
The code developed in this study is open source and can be publicly available at https://github.com/CUG-EMI/HMCMT2D under the GNU General Public License v3.0.
thautwarm/lume
🔥 Static site generator for Deno 🦕
thautwarm/morei
thautwarm/pmakefile
thautwarm/ts-refl
Extract TypeScript interface definitions into clarified representations